Cost-Benefit Analysis
Example Calculation:
Manual Cost: 200 statements × 0.5 hours × $25 = $2,500/month
Automated Processing Time: 6 minutes per statement (80% time reduction) Automated Cost: 200 × 0.1 hours × $25 = $500/month
Monthly Savings: $2,000 Annual Savings: $24,000
Beyond cost savings, improved accuracy reduces costly financial errors and audit risks.

FAQs
Q1: How do I convert Bank of America statements to CSV automatically? Use a bank statement converter with OCR technology that supports batch processing and exports to CSV format.
Q2: What is the best way to convert PDF bank statements to Excel? Automated PDF to Excel converters with template mapping ensure accurate extraction and formatting.
Q3: Can I convert PDF to QBO for QuickBooks import? Yes, many tools offer direct PDF to QBO conversion, streamlining QuickBooks bank statement import.
Q4: Is automated bank statement conversion secure? Reputable tools use encryption and comply with GDPR and SOX to protect sensitive financial data.
Q5: How do I batch convert bank statements efficiently? Choose software that supports batch uploads and automated processing to handle multiple statements simultaneously.
Q6: What compliance considerations apply to bank statement conversion? Ensure tools maintain audit trails, data encryption, and comply with relevant financial regulations.
Q7: Can I convert PDF to OFX format? Yes, PDF to OFX conversion tools are available for importing data into various accounting software.
